Tel Malhata
Tel Malhata is an archaeological site in Southern District, Israel. Tel Malhata is situated nearby to the aerodrome Nevatim Airbase.| Tap on a place to explore it |

Nevatim Airbase
Aerodrome
Photo: IDF Spokesperson’s Unit, CC BY-SA 3.0.
Nevatim Airbase, also Air Force Base 28, is an Israeli Air Force base, located 15 km east-southeast of Beersheba, near moshav Nevatim in the northern Negev desert.

Kuseife
Village
Photo: Meronim, CC BY-SA 3.0.
Kuseife or Kseifa is a Bedouin town organized as a local council in the Southern District of Israel. Kuseife was founded in 1982 as part of a government project to plan and build towns for Negev Bedouins. Kuseife is situated 7 km northeast of Tel Malhata.
Kuhlih
Village
Kukhleh is a Negev Bedouin village in southern Israel. Located between the Bedouin towns of Hura and Kuseife, it falls under the jurisdiction of al-Kasom Regional Council. In 2023 it had a population of 344. Kuhlih is situated 8 km north of Tel Malhata.
Sa’wah
Hamlet
Mulada, also known as Sa'wa, is a Bedouin village in the Negev desert in southern Israel. Sa’wah is situated 8 km northwest of Tel Malhata.
